Amazing 1886 Gold Dollar, MS67
1886 G$1 MS67 NGC. CAC. An amazing Superb Gem with exquisite aesthetic appeal, this piece will easily please any connoisseur. Both sides are highly lustrous with gorgeous light orange toning over rich yellow-gold surfaces. It has few peers, and none that are graded finer. The 1886, with a mintage of 5,000 coins, is the least available of all dates in the 1880s. Census: 13 in 67, 0 finer (4/09).(Registry values: N2998)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 25DR, PCGS# 7587, GSID# 8049)
Metal: 90% Gold, 10% Copper
Weight: 1.67 grams
AGW: 0.04838oz
Melt Value: $47.27
Gold Spot: $977/oz (05-29-2009)
Mintage: 5,000
